Stone Free and Ice Palace in Rifle Mountain Park, CO on 1-4-14

Stone Free and Ice Palace in Rifle Mountain Park, CO on 1-4-14. The recent sunny, warm spell laid waste to Ice Palace but Stone Free has faired well but doesn’t appear to have been climbed yet (again, we think). Update from 1-7-14: I did hear word that someone climbed Stone Free but word was that it was pretty heads up.
